We’re Looking For:

We are seeking a Business Intelligence Engineer who is solutions-oriented, proactive, and thrives in ambiguity. This individual will not simply respond to requests but will lead initiatives, identify opportunities, and use data to unlock business growth. You will play a key role in maintaining data flow across systems, building scalable data models, and partnering across teams to inform decision-making. The ideal candidate will have 2+ years of experience in Business Intelligence and Data Warehousing, with deep expertise in SQL, data pipelines, visualization tools, and cloud-based data architecture.

You Will:

Take ownership of the Business Intelligence domain, surfacing insights, solving problems, and driving data-driven decisions

Partner with stakeholders in product, sales, and operations to ensure data quality, availability, and effective usage

Manipulate and transform large datasets using SQL and scripting languages to generate impactful business insights

Design, execute, and analyze A/B tests and other experiments to optimize strategies

Apply data science fundamentals to build predictive models and trend analyses

Develop scalable data models, dashboards, and reports using tools such as Domo

Continuously improve data pipelines, infrastructure, and analytical capabilities

Mentor colleagues to enhance analytics capabilities and foster a data-driven culture

Who You Will Work With:

This role reports into Director of Performance Optimization Analytics of the and collaborates cross-functionally with Product, Sales, Operations, and Data Engineering teams. You will also work closely with senior leadership to support key strategic initiatives.

Must Have’s:

2+ years of experience in Data Warehousing and Business Intelligence

Advanced SQL skills and experience with relational databases (e.g., Snowflake, Redshift, Oracle, SQL Server)

Strong experience in ETL/ELT development and data pipeline management

Proficiency in scripting languages (e.g., Python, JavaScript, Java, Scala)

Strong foundation in data modeling, governance, and structuring datasets for long-term use

Expertise in data visualization and dashboarding (Domo preferred)

Advanced spreadsheet skills (Excel, Google Sheets)

Self-starter with strong problem-solving and strategic thinking capabilities
